    Bisharp Collector’s Guide: Team Up (sm9-105)

    Character Intro

    Bisharp from the Team Up set is a Rare Metal-type Stage 1 Pokémon with 110 HP. It features the attack Power Edge and is numbered 105 in the collection.

    Quick Facts

    set_name release_date number rarity hp illustrator
    Team Up 105 Rare 110 Anesaki Dynamic
    • Type: Metal
    • Stage: Stage 1 (Evolves from Pawniard)
    • Weakness: Fire (×2)
    • Resistance: Psychic (-20)
    • Retreat Cost: 2
    • Flavor Text: “Bisharp pursues prey in the company of a large group of Pawniard. Then Bisharp finishes off the prey.”

    Key Printings

    This exact printing of Bisharp appears in the Sun & Moon Team Up set with card number 105.

    • Attacks:
    • Single Lunge — 30+ damage; deals an additional 90 damage if Bisharp has no damage counters.
    • Power Edge — 90 damage.

    Bisharp (Obsidian Flames 149) Collectors Guide

    Character Intro

    Bisharp is a Common from Obsidian Flames (#149) with 110 HP and the headline attack Fury Cutter. A clean, straightforward Stage 1 that appeals to collectors and casual players for its simplicity and sharp artwork.

    Quick Facts

    set_name release_date number rarity hp illustrator
    Obsidian Flames 149 Common 110 GIDORA
    • Type: Metal
    • Stage: Stage 1 (Evolves from Pawniard)
    • Weakness: Fire ×2
    • Resistance: Grass -30
    • Retreat Cost: 2
    • Regulation Mark: G
    • Attacks:
    • Metal Claw: Deals 20 damage with a Metal energy cost.
    • Fury Cutter: Costs Metal and Colorless energy; flip 3 coins to increase damage from 50 up to 170 based on heads flipped.

    Key Printings

    This exact printing appears in the Obsidian Flames set as card number 149. It is a Common illustrated by GIDORA, featuring a vivid, commanding depiction of Bisharp.

    Variants & Identifiers

    There are no known print variants for this card. It is identified by its set code “sv3-149” and regulation mark “G.” The card’s Metal type, Stage 1 subtype, and attack combination help distinguish it from other Bisharp printings.
